In this study, I was seeking a deeper connection with emotional expression in the physical world, allowing deep-seated feelings to have a physical voice and presence. Tapping into and verbalizing my true emotions has been a lifelong struggle, except when I was expressing those feelings as a vocalist. When I lost the ability to sing a few years back, due to some health issues, I felt emotionally broken, with no way to free the ever-increasing build up of feeling. Without getting too personal, I was also dealing with some trauma from the past I simply couldn’t release and I needed a way to take what was inside and put it outside, where I could better analyze, bless it, and send it on its way. Emotion and Form has been a healing opportunity, allowing feelings and intuitions that were harmed or trapped to be released and expressed. Each piece represents both inner and outer conversations with my soul. What was lost with my ability to sing, has been found in paint. My hope is that these conversations in mixed media may help to heal and invite free expression from those who bring them into their lives, homes, and environments.
